Political comedy Ella McCay has arrived in cinemas, but what songs are included in the film? Find out below.
The film is the latest from veteran Hollywood director James L. Brooks, known for Terms Of Endearment, Broadcast News and As Good As It Gets, as well as co-creating The Simpsons.
It stars Sex Education’s Emma Mackey as the titular character, an idealistic 34-year-old politician who takes on the role of state governor when her mentor is drafted into the incoming Obama administration.
Jamie Lee Curtis plays Ella’s Aunt Helen and Jack Lowden is her husband Ryan, while Kumail Nanjiani, Ayo Edebiri, Julie Kavner, Rebecca Hall, Albert Brooks and Woody Harrelson all co-star.

The film premiered in Los Angeles on Tuesday (December 9) and was released in cinemas three days later by 20th Century Studios.
It is Brooks’ first film as director since 2010’s How Do You Know, which featured his regular collaborator Jack Nicholson’s final film role, alongside Reese Witherspoon, Owen Wilson and Paul Rudd.
Every song on the Ella McCay soundtrack
The film includes an original score from the legendary composer Hans Zimmer, the double Oscar winner known for his work on Gladiator, The Dark Knight, Inception, Dune and No Time To Die, among many others.
The trailer also included two slices of classic rock in the form of Fleetwood Mac’s ‘Go Your Own Way’ and Joe Cocker’s ‘Feelin’ Alright’.
